The Wizards go for their seventh consecutive win at the Verizon Center on Sunday evening against a faltering Raptors squad. A win would give the franchise its longest home win streak since the 2006-07 season, when Gilbert Arenas and company led the club to ten straight home wins.
Bradley Beal is still a game-time decision for the game, but his return could be a major boost for Washington. The rookie has thrived in two games against Toronto this season, averaging 22.5 points per game on 53 percent shooting.
